The Life Enrichment Specialist role must exhibit genuine interest in residents and show patience and understanding while working with communities, team members, residents, families and visitors. This position is responsible for supporting communities with vacant Assisted Living Coordinator (AL), Reflections Coordinator (RC) Life Enrichment Director (LED) and Life Enrichment Coordinator (LEC) positions, in multiple communities and locations.

The Specialist will manage all facets of service and activities, addressing resident needs in the area in which they are filling in for: Assisted Living, Memory Care or Life Enrichment. 

When acting as a Life Enrichment Director, the Specialist will plan, coordinate, facilitate and direct resident life enrichment activity programs utilizing resources of the facility and community.

Duties and Responsibilities of the Position

  • Organize programs for group and individual activities based on each resident’s personal interests, needs, abilities and potential as identified in the “To Know Me is to Love Me” lifestyle review and individual service plans. Formulate a life enrichment plan for each resident, to review and update according to established policies.
  • Maintain a balanced recreational and wellness program, including social, intellectual, physical, purposeful, spiritual, leisure and creative opportunities.
  • Ensure daily scheduled activities are carried out and delivered with purpose and quality.
  • Facilitate and leads life enrichment activities, classes and programs as needed in all levels of lifestyles/neighborhoods.
  • Work with the Care & Wellness team to deliver resident-directed, inclusive, purposeful and meaningful daily activities with Reflections residents.
  • Coordinate weekly Resident Outings/Excursions. LED may be assigned to oversee the Transportation Program for the community, including driving residents to appointments on occasion, and assisting residents on outings which may include driving company vehicles/vans.
  • Motivate, coordinate and support resident-led programs, committees/councils, resident ambassador and new resident welcome program.
  • Direct the Community Volunteer Program. Oversee the meaningful use of volunteers in the community to enhance resident engagement and support other departments.
  • Organize, communicate and execute vibrant community events, WOW moments and celebrations in collaboration with the ED, EC, DCR and other department heads to enhance resident, family and team member engagement.
  • Champion and utilize Lifeloop technology to its full potential, teaching others to use it.
  • Evaluate community needs quarterly for all lifestyle neighborhoods and formulate initiatives and programs based on resident feedback, needs and survey results.
  • Support residents with technological needs.
  • Prepare and post Monthly Lifestyle Calendars indicating scheduled activities, times, locations. Calendar should reflect the residents’ physical, intellectual, social and cultural and religious interests, appeal to men and women and all age groups living in the community. Programs and activities will take place in a variety of locations (i.e. indoor/outdoor and the broader community.) Calendar will include seasonal and special events.
  • Ability and willingness to travel as necessary (greater than 50% likely). 
  • Prepare and update monthly LE bulletin board and Wall of Veterans board.
  • Maintain adequate LE supplies and equipment in good condition to meet the needs and interests of residents, and ensure materials are available to residents.
  • Ensure life enrichment spaces are clean, organized, inviting and accessible to residents.
